If the back of your apple watch loses contact with your skin, you should tighten your watch band. You can use apple's printable sizing tool to help you find the right fit before buying. To test whether your watch is too loose, shake your wrist and then turn your palm face up. The watch needs to be tight against your skin to work, but not so tight that it irritates or is uncomfortable.
